05.03.2013 - What coal CEOs are saying entering 2013
Coal has been beaten up in the media and the markets over the past year or so. Being outspoken against coal has been made easy by cheaper, cleaner-burning natural gas, which has been produced in abundance here in the United States recently. To tackle reductions in both demand and price, coal companies in the U.S. were forced to curtail production and capital spending in preparation for future production. Entering 2013, could the coal market finally have found a trough?
